Hello,

I installed the new RavenNuke 7.6 2.0 and it works great, except that most of the themes are missing the Right Blocks.

Is there some code that I can add to allow me to have the Right Blocks back?


Thanks

T
View user's profile Send private message
dezina
Theme Guru


Joined: Dec 26, 2002
Posts: 57
Location: UK

PostPosted: Mon Jan 09, 2006 2:57 am Reply with quote Back to top

Code:
In your theme.php find:
if ($index == 1) {

and change to:
if (defined('INDEX_FILE')) {

Make sure that your modules have define('INDEX_FILE', true); in them for the ones that you want the right blocks to appear.
